  • A [rail] enthusiast who follows a particular type of rail traction (for example Class 37 locomotives) and tries to travel as many miles as possible behind their chosen type of [locomotive] to earn the respect of fellow bashers.
    They bash trains (travelling behind a specimen of their chosen locomotive class) for the purpose of their own enjoyment, they often [lean out] of windows to hear the engine noise better and often wave their arms in the air (in a manner which can confuse and send dangerous messages to [railway] staff) to show their appreciation of the engine [hauling] their train.
    They are the arch-enemy of many rail staff who are not enthusiasts or bashers themselves as their exploits, can be [time wasting] - one wave bashers specialize in is waving his (they are rarely hers) arm upwards to show that he does not believe the driver is applying enough power to make a suitable noise from the locomotive (despite the fact that it could damage the train if too much power was applied to quickly), this sign, to all rail staff means: APPLY BRAKES, and this sign is often used in an emergency.

  • In London a Basher refers to a cheap [pay as you go] phone. Generally the two types of people who use them are 1) Criminals who want to minimise the risk of having their phones tapped or [traced], or 2) Legit persons who use one alongside a decent contract phone, maybe because they like to separate their calls/contacts for example [splitting] between business/personal or because theyre worried about losing a phone and dont want to lose a nicer phone, for example if theyre going to a club or if they are in a dangerous line of work.
    The term Basher originated from the idea that one can bash the phone around without worrying because 1) The cheap phones typically used are usually [simpler] and more [robust] than more expensive phones so they are less likely to break, and 2) Even if the phone breaks you dont care about it.
